So.. You’re pregnant and you’re wondering about the different options you have for birth. Although this process can seem complicated, it doesn’t need to be stressful. First, let’s consider the options in Indiana, the great Hoosier state.
Hospital This option is the most used within Indiana. Typically families that have chosen an Ob/Gyn or hospital based Midwife as their care provider will birth at the hospital. Birth Center In the Indy area there is one free-standing birth center, Sacred Roots. This birth center consists of a team of CNM’s. They have a collaborating agreement with the local hospital should any difficulty arise. They assist with most births with the exception being high-risk births and VBAC’s. (vaginal birth after cesarean). Home Birth Indianapolis has a pretty diverse selection when it comes to this option. Depending on personality, birth location, health history, and your due date, any one of these midwives could be a great fit.
